XAMLファイルとは

XAMLファイルを開く、編集する、変換する方法

XAML ファイル拡張子 ( "zammel"と発音されます )を持つファイルは、同じ名前のMicrosoftのマークアップ言語を使用して作成されたExtensible Application Markup Languageファイルです。

XAMLはXMLベースの言語なので、.XAMLファイルは基本的に単なるテキストファイルです 。 XAMLファイルは、Webページを表すためにHTMLファイルを使用するのと同様に、Windows Phoneアプリケーション、Windowsストアアプリケーションなどのソフトウェアアプリケーションのユーザーインターフェイス要素を記述します。

XAMLのコンテンツはC#のような他の言語でも表現できますが、XAMLはXMLに基づいているためコンパイルする必要はないため、開発者がXMLを使用する方が簡単です。

代わりにXAMLファイルが.XOMLファイル拡張子を使用することがあります。

XAMLファイルを開く方法

XAMLファイルは.NETプログラミングで使用されるため、MicrosoftのVisual Studioで開くこともできます。

ただし、テキストベースのXMLファイルなので、XAMLファイルはWindowsのメモ帳やその他のテキストエディタで開いたり編集したりすることもできます 。 これはまた、どのXMLエディタもXAMLファイルを開くことができることを意味します。Liquid XML Studioは注目すべき例です。

注:一部のXAMLファイルは、これらのプログラムやマークアップ言語とはまったく関係がありません。 上記のいずれのソフトウェアも動作していない場合(テキストエディタで混乱したテキストのみが表示されている場合など)、テキストを調べて、ファイルのフォーマットや使用されているプログラムその特定のXAMLファイルをビルドします。

ヒント:ファイルの中には.XAMLと非常によく似たファイル拡張子を持つものもありますが、同じ種類のファイルであることや、同じツールを使用して開いたり、編集したり、変換することはできません。 これは、Microsoft ExcelのXLAMやXAIML Chatterbot Databaseファイルなどのファイルに当てはまります。

最後に、1つのプログラムがデフォルトでコンピュータ上のXAMLファイルを開くが、別のプログラムで実際にXAMLファイルを開く場合は、Windowsでのファイルの関連付けを変更する方法を参照してください。

XAMLファイルを変換する方法

XAMLをHTMLに手動で変換するには、XML要素を正しいHTMLに置き換えます。 これは、テキストエディタで行うことができます。 Stack Overflowにはこれを行うための情報が少しあります。これは参考になるかもしれません。 また、MicrosoftのXAMLからHTMLへの変換のデモを参照してください。

XAMLファイルをPDFに変換する場合は、XAMLファイルをPDF形式のファイルに「印刷」できるいくつかのプログラムについて、 この無料のPDF作成者のリストを参照してください。 doPDFは多くの例の1つです。

Visual StudioはXAMLファイルを他の多くのテキストベースの形式に保存できるはずです。 Visual Studio用のHTML5拡張用のC3 / XAMLもあり、CシャープやXAML言語で書かれたファイルを使ってHTML5アプリケーションを構築することができます。

XAMLファイルに関するその他のヘルプ

ソーシャルネットワークまたは電子メールで私に連絡する方法、テクニカルサポートフォーラムに投稿する方法などの詳細については、 その他のヘルプを参照してください。 XAMLファイルを開いたり使用したりする際にどのような問題が発生しているかを教えてください。

マイクロソフトには、XAMLに関する追加情報もあります。